Just Keep Swimming

Hello, Friends!  Marilyn here with a scrapbook layout.  I created this underwater scene using images from Miss Kate's Cuttables and a couple of Internet images that were traced.  My tip:  Use the Print and Cut feature on your Silhouette to make your images.  


 The fish, water bubbles, waves and title are all from Miss Kate's Cuttables.  Import the PNG images into your Silhouette program, then trace.  You will be left with a Print and Cut image that can be re-sized to fit your project.

The scuba diver was found with an internet search.  I imported the image and traced, creating a print and cut image.

Seaweed images were also found with an internet search.  They are all the same image, just re-sized and flipped.  Seaweed was printed on Square1.
Stickles were added to water bubbles.  Edges of images were inked using Tim Holtz Faded Blue Jeans Distress Ink.

Seek Ye First the Kingdom of God

Hello, Friends.  We just completed the first week of Lent 2014.  I found this word art on Word Art Wednesday website (Jan 8, 2014).  It was so lovely and just happened to be my goal this Lent - to seek God's Kingdom first.

A2 sized card = 5.5" x 4.25"

Sentiment = from Word Art Wednesday.  Sentiment mat mounted with foam tape.


Cross = found with Internet search.  
Designer paper = digital paper from Doodle Pantry
